About the role

The Director, Group Retirement Services, will be responsible for all tax compliance and related risk management. This role will work closely with Corporate Tax, Legal and Compliance to ensure all tax legislation is appropriately interpreted and applied. You have financial services tax experience, experience in managing a tax department and an interest in operations and compliance. You are no stranger to strong processes and possess strong leadership and communication skills along with the ability to proactively improve processes and manage risk.

What you'll be doing
  • Accountable for the annual GRS tax production process of over 1.6 million tax slips, as well as annual tax return filings.
  • Accountable for interpreting Foreign Account Tax Compliance Act (FATCA) and Common Reporting Standard (CRS) legislation, and for ensuring all applicable filings are processed accurately and on time.
  • Accountable for interpretating US Qualified Intermediary (QI) requirements and ensuring all applicable Internal Revenue Service (IRS) filings are processed accurately and on time.
  • Participate in CRA audits, including FATCA and CRS, and the QI periodic review conducted by an external reviewer.
  • Accountable for ensuring that policies, practices and administration systems are in compliance with all applicable tax laws.
  • Responsible for ensuring appropriate controls and procedures are in place to maintain the integrity of product tax reporting.
  • Actively participate in product development activities and provide sign-off and assurance that all tax-related implications are properly addressed.
  • Monitor, interpret, make recommendations and communicate the impact of Federal and Provincial tax legislation on products, processes and marketing materials to the affected departments
  • Participate on the CLHIA policyholder tax committee to lobby for the development of appropriate tax legislation for retirement and savings products.
  • Participate in FATCA/CRS CLHIA committees, and other External Advisory teams.
  • Represent the GRS business within the Canadian Tax community at Sun Life, at CLHIA and at various divisions at the Canada Revenue Agency.
  • Answer inquiries regarding current taxation and rule interpretations from all areas within GRS including analyzing corporate actions.
  • Work closely with GRS IT and Canadian Finance on all tax related initiatives to ensure that changes made to the tax process are implemented correctly.
  • Consult with other resources in the Company (Corporate Tax, Legal, and Compliance) to present recommendations on appropriate business practices and strategies.
  • Evaluate the tax risk to GRS products where tax legislation is unclear or ambiguous.
  • Provide training and education to administrative staff, Client Relationship Executives and sales representatives to enhance their knowledge and understanding of tax concepts and issues.
  • Review contents of product sales materials to ensure that appropriate tax disclosure is included.
  • Managing and providing guidance to members of the GRS tax team including 3 direct reports.
  • Manage third party risk management for vendors GRS Tax oversees.
